What is the specs of Audi TT 2. TFSI 2010?

The base-model TT 2. TFSI features a 2. I4 engine that produces 200 horsepower at 5,100 – 6,000 rpm and 207 pound-feet of torque at 1,800 – 5,000 rpm. An S tronic six-speed automatic transmission is standard. According to Audi, the TT 2. Is the Audi TT 2. TFSI reliable?

The consensus from owners is that the TT boasts commendable reliability, with very few reports of significant mechanical failures. There were reports of minor electronic issues, but these were typically resolved without inconvenience. Prefer: 2012 second-generation Audi TT for a good balance of reliability, performance, and safety.There are several reasons why Audi has decided to discontinue the TT. One reason is the declining sales of the TT in recent years. Another significant factor is Audi’s strategic shift towards electric vehicles, with the automaker announcing a substantial €15 billion investment in electric vehicles by 2025.
